Comment 2 for bug 1096914

Revision history for this message
Michael Terry (mterry) wrote :

I see this when building, and it doesn't stop the build. Seems wrong?

./testr run --parallel
Traceback (most recent call last):
  File "/usr/lib/python2.7/runpy.py", line 162, in _run_module_as_main
    "__main__", fname, loader, pkg_name)
  File "/usr/lib/python2.7/runpy.py", line 72, in _run_code
    exec code in run_globals
  File "/usr/lib/python2.7/dist-packages/subunit/run.py", line 75, in <module>
    stdout=sys.stdout)
  File "/usr/lib/python2.7/dist-packages/testtools/run.py", line 164, in __init__
    self.parseArgs(argv)
  File "/usr/lib/python2.7/dist-packages/testtools/run.py", line 241, in parseArgs
    self.createTests()
  File "/usr/lib/python2.7/dist-packages/testtools/run.py", line 250, in createTests
    self.module)
  File "/usr/lib/python2.7/unittest/loader.py", line 128, in loadTestsFromNames
    suites = [self.loadTestsFromName(name, module) for name in names]
  File "/usr/lib/python2.7/unittest/loader.py", line 113, in loadTestsFromName
    test = obj()
  File "testrepository/tests/__init__.py", line 88, in test_suite
    result.addTests(generate_scenarios(pkg.test_suite()))
  File "testrepository/tests/commands/__init__.py", line 36, in test_suite
    return loader.loadTestsFromNames(module_names)
  File "/usr/lib/python2.7/unittest/loader.py", line 128, in loadTestsFromNames
    suites = [self.loadTestsFromName(name, module) for name in names]
  File "/usr/lib/python2.7/unittest/loader.py", line 100, in loadTestsFromName
    parent, obj = obj, getattr(obj, part)
AttributeError: 'module' object has no attribute 'test_slowest'
running=${PYTHON:-python} -m subunit.run --list testrepository.tests.test_suite
PASSED (id=0)